The 3-day Multiconference ‘ICETE 2026’, a flagship event hosted by NMAM Institute of Technology, Nitte was inaugurated on 5th February 2026 by the Chief Guest, Dr. Sunil Kumar Singh, Director, CSIR-National Institute of Oceanography (NIO), Goa. The conference brought together eminent academicians, researchers and professionals from around the world to discuss advancements in various domains under the umbrella of NITTE-BIO 2026, CTCS 2026, AIDE 2026, AREEV 2026, VSPICE 2026, SME 2026 and MSMAT 2026.
In his inaugural address, Dr. Singh emphasized the opportunities that Indian researchers need to grab in the field of research. He stated that the country’s research sector should not be confined to just learning but should move towards knowledge creation. He called for the effective utilization of various schemes of the Central Government, including the Prime Minister's Research Fellowship, which is aimed at promoting research and innovation.
Guests of Honour included prominent figures: Prof. Yasuhiro Shiomi, Vice Dean/ Professor College of Science & Engineering, Ritsumeikan University, Kyoto, Japan; Dr. In Ho Ra, Professor, School of Computer & Software, Kunsan National University, South Korea; Dr. Hesham Nabiel, Professor, Dept. of Mathematics, Faculty of Science, Al-Azhar University, Nasr City, Cairo, Egypt and Dr. Mohammed Ibrahim, Associate Professor Universiti Teknologi Malaysia. Each shared valuable insights, stressing the importance of interdisciplinary research in addressing global challenges.
Dr. Gopal Mugeraya, Vice President (Technical Education), Nitte University, who presided over the event, lauded the efforts of the Organizing Committee and reiterated the institution's commitment to nurturing research and development.
The Conference Proceedings book was released on the occasion.
Dr. Niranjan N Chiplunkar, Principal, NMAMIT welcomed the gathering. Chief Convenor of the Conference & Dean (R&D), Dr. Sudesh Bekal gave a comprehensive presentation regarding the conference. Conference Secretary & Professor in Electronics & Communication Engineering Dr. Prabha Niranjan delivered the vote of thanks. Dr. Anusha R Sharath, Asst. Professor, Dept of E&C and Ms. Shweta Bharath, Asst. Professor, Dept. of Humanities were the masters of ceremony. During the 3-day conference, 14 experts from various disciplines of technology delivered keynote addresses. 1380 quality research papers were received from national and international researchers, out of which 552 papers were shortlisted for presentation after expert review and 289 papers were presented during this multiconference.
